"Pretty dependable car with little to no issues"
"I bought this car with around 175 thousand miles and I'm close to 183 and I've had basically no issues with this car aside from normal ware and tare. I've only had to get new brakes and rotors since I've had it. No engine problems at all. Very dependable car, drives 4 hour round trip twice a week on top of everyday driving. I get regular check ups and oil changes as did the owners before me. Good 3800 motor in it. Nice smooth comfortable ride"
"Fun car wonder why there weren’t so many made"
"I bought my 06 gxp burgundy chrome rims back in March of 19... had 103k miles 3 owner for 5000$. Was 20 years old so definitely a fun fast nice looking car for me. Tranny would get super hot over 220 degrees (there’s a digital gage for it) ended up getting a tranny cooler put on but was too late because a month later my tranny blew with 119k. Got a rebuild for 2600 50k mile warranty. Had a couple lines replaced over the year. Bought tires and brakes , oil change every 3k. 400$ Monroe struts all around replaced, sway bar links. Had wheel hub assembly’s replaced on both front side, 300$ each, and water pump recently done for 500$. Has the ls4 v8 5.3 so also got a custom exhaust and got a remote tune by JOATS. Disables the annoying DOD which is basically an old outdated eco mode that can make it use 4/6 cylinders depending how you drive. Car is fun but once they got over 100k you’re bound to get into problems and not all parts for this car are cheap, car is rare and fun. 3/5 stars in general"
"Love my Pontiac!"
"I bought my 04 Grand Prix in 2005 with 67k miles when I graduated high school. It’s somehow still going.. I’m not going to lie, I’ve put this car through A LOT, from accidentally setting it on fire, by dropping oil on a hot engine when topping fluids, to driving it through flood water (sucked water in), to one car accident… Still going at 249,768 miles. It’s very spacious, I’ve carried toilets in it, doors, bags of cement, cement boards, bags and bags of dirt, it’s my work horse. My transmission started doing some odd stuff last year, but it had a twisted gasket that caused a small tranny fluid leak. Fixed that and it’s been acting normal ever since. Not sure how I’ll ever get rid of it, it’s been extremely reliable. Long live the Pontiac!"

NHTSA Safety Rating
According to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), the 2004 Pontiac Grand Prix front-side driver crash test rating is 3 out of 5 stars. The front-side passenger crash test rating is 4 out of 5.
